Latest Patents

His latest patents include a "Method of Combining Compressed Signal" and a "Fronthaul Multiplexer." The method of combining compressed signals involves a technique for merging IQ data of uplink signals that have been compressed without decompression. This is achieved through various compression methods, including block floating point compression, block scaling compression, and a-law compression. The fronthaul multiplexer patent focuses on combining uplink packets in a compressed state received from multiple radio units. This invention allows for immediate accumulation and combination of uplink packets upon receipt or for their recompression using a highly efficient compression method when stored in memory, ultimately reducing memory usage.
